Understanding the Core Mechanic

At its heart, the Megaways system replaces fixed paylines with cascading reels where the number of symbols per reel can vary from spin to spin. This creates thousands of ways to win, but the random symbol modifier adds another layer of complexity. Instead of relying solely on the position of symbols, the game software introduces a rule where specific icons can appear unexpectedly or transform during the base game or free spins. This mechanic is designed to increase engagement by introducing variance that feels organic rather than scripted.

The technical execution involves the random number generator deciding when a modifier activates. It might turn a standard scatter into a wild, or expand a low-value symbol into a high-paying one for a single round. For the player, this means that a spin that looks like a loser on the surface can suddenly shift into a payout cluster as symbols change identity. It is a sophisticated use of probability that keeps the volatility high without breaking the underlying return-to-player percentage established by the provider.

How Symbols Transform During Play

When the modifier triggers, the visual feedback is usually immediate and clear. A symbol might glow, expand, or change colour to indicate its new status. This transformation is not permanent across the entire session but lasts for a set number of spins or until a specific condition is met. The randomness ensures that no two sessions play out exactly the same way, which is crucial for maintaining interest among seasoned punters who have seen every standard feature in the book.

From a gameplay perspective, this means players need to watch the grid closely rather than just chasing the highest multiplier. A seemingly insignificant symbol becoming a high-value icon can complete a cluster that was previously incomplete. Responsible Gambling Considerations

High-volatility features like random symbol modifiers can lead to rapid bankroll fluctuations. While the potential for wins is higher, the risk of losing streaks is also amplified. Australian regulations require operators to provide tools for self-exclusion, deposit limits, and reality checks. Players should utilise these safeguards, especially when engaging with games that have unpredictable payout structures. It is easy to get caught up in the excitement of a transforming symbol, but maintaining control is paramount.

Technical Nuances and Provider Differences

Not every game using the Megaways label implements the random symbol modifier in the same way. Some providers tie it to free spins only, while others allow it to occur in the base game. The frequency of activation is determined by the game’s mathematical model, which is rarely disclosed in full detail to the public. Players should read the help sections of each specific title to understand the triggers and limitations. What works on one platform might feel completely different on another due to these subtle variations.

Software updates can also change how these features behave over time. Providers occasionally tweak the algorithms to balance player engagement with profitability. This means a game that was generous with modifiers last year might behave differently today. Staying informed about game updates and reading community feedback can help players choose titles that match their preferred risk profile.
